MrBeast Is Going To Make A Zombie Apocalypse Show

During a recent episode of The Joe Rogan Experience, Joe Rogan pitched a simple but compelling idea to MrBeast: place contestants inside an abandoned city and challenge them to survive against waves of zombies.

 

What began as a casual suggestion quickly evolved into a detailed creative session. The two explored how such a competition could function, turning a basic premise into a structured, high-stakes format.

 

 

From Survival Game to Major Production

 

As the concept developed, MrBeast began thinking in terms of scale and execution. He estimated that producing a realistic post-apocalyptic setting could cost between $5 million and $10 million, especially if an entire location had to be redesigned.

 

He also hinted at how quickly he was drawn to the idea, joking that he felt like calling his team immediately to start planning.

 

 

Gameplay Mechanics Take Shape

 

The pair mapped out how the competition would unfold. Contestants would use daylight hours to gather supplies, complete challenges, and build defenses. Once night falls, they would face increasingly dangerous zombie encounters.

 

To keep tension high, MrBeast suggested a dynamic prize system where rewards increase with each day survived.

 

At the same time, daily objectives could make survival progressively harder, forcing participants to take bigger risks.

 

 

Casting and Twists

 

They also discussed who might take part in such a challenge. Ideas included recruiting survival experts, martial artists, or even former military personnel to add credibility and intensity.

 

 

One of the more creative twists involved eliminated contestants returning as zombies, turning former competitors into part of the threat and constantly reshaping the game.

 

 

Additional Features and Atmosphere

 

Rogan contributed ideas to enhance immersion and difficulty. These included zombies with glowing features for visibility, limited flashlight batteries to create tension, and mechanics that force contestants to hide throughout the city after dark.

 

These elements helped transform the idea from a loose concept into something resembling a fully planned production.

 

 

A Project That Could Actually Happen

 

As the conversation continued, MrBeast became increasingly enthusiastic, noting that the concept felt achievable despite its ambitious scale. He even suggested that a streaming platform could potentially fund such a project.

 

Although no official plans have been announced, the discussion clearly moved beyond brainstorming into a well-developed vision. And we all know MrBeast... he can do anything he wants.
